Lets compare vitamin content per 100 grams of Dry Bread Crumbs vs Red Kidney Beans:
- 100 grams of Dry Bread Crumbs have 1.6 times more Vitamin B1, 1.9 times more Vitamin B2, 3.1 times more Vitamin B3 and more Vitamin B12 than Red Kidney Beans.
- While 100 g of Raw Red Kidney Beans contain 1.4 times more Vitamin B5, 3.3 times more Vitamin B6, 3.7 times more Vitamin B9 and more Vitamin C than Plain Grated Dry Bread Crumbs .
- Both Dry Bread Crumbs and Red Kidney Beans provide similar amounts of Vitamin K per 100 grams.
- 100 grams of Dry Bread Crumbs have insufficient amounts of Vitamin C
- 100 grams of Red Kidney Beans have insufficient amounts of Vitamin B12
- Both Plain Grated Dry Bread Crumbs as well as Raw Red Kidney Beans have insufficient amounts of Vitamin A, Vitamin D and Vitamin E in 100 grams.
Comparing minerals per 100 grams for Dry Bread Crumbs vs Red Kidney Beans:
- 100 grams of Dry Bread Crumbs have 2.2 times more Calcium, 7.9 times more Selenium and 61 times more Sodium than Red Kidney Beans.
- While 100 g of Raw Red Kidney Beans contain 2.7 times more Copper, 1.4 times more Iron, 3.2 times more Magnesium, 2.5 times more Phosphorus, 6.9 times more Potassium and 1.9 times more Zinc than Plain Grated Dry Bread Crumbs .
- Both Dry Bread Crumbs and Red Kidney Beans contain similar levels of Manganese per 100 grams.
Comparison of macro-nutrients per 100 grams:
- 100 grams of Dry Bread Crumbs have 5 times more Fat, 7.8 times more Saturated Fat, 8.2 times more Omega 6 and 3 times more Sugars than Red Kidney Beans.
- While 100 g of Raw Red Kidney Beans contain 1.9 times more Omega 3, 3.4 times more Fiber and 1.7 times more Protein than Plain Grated Dry Bread Crumbs .
- Both Dry Bread Crumbs and Red Kidney Beans offer comparable quantities of Energy and Carbohydrate per 100 grams.
- 100 grams of Red Kidney Beans provide inadequate amounts of Omega 6
